Transaction 488847b5ea368425d9d86dfd108e601d37e665fefae485b399e5fcba2d125451

6 Input
2 Outputs
  • 488847b5ea368425d9d86dfd108e601d37e665fefae485b399e5fcba2d125451:0
  • value  43205611
    address  3Q9hHzzPLbW62XFjRc36pSaZ1PdTQJLPAi
  • 488847b5ea368425d9d86dfd108e601d37e665fefae485b399e5fcba2d125451:1
  • value  1000000000
    address  39ZX7Lp2PbmHg7ozQANW59H9GXq8PzQNxe